Title: Kazimierz Kuratowski (1896–1980) His Life and Work in Topology
Abstract: Kazimierz Kuratowski was born in Warsaw on February 2, 1896, in the family of an eminent lawyer. His father, caring for patriotic education of his children, sent him to a Polish school, although — in then Russian Warsaw — graduation from such a school did not grant any privileges. In 1913 the young Kuratowski went to Moscow to pass official, Russian, graduation; having finished a Polish school, he had very little chance to pass such a graduation in Warsaw. Since after the 1905 school strike Polish youths boycotted the Russian university in Warsaw, Kuratowski went abroad to study. He passed the school year 1913–14 at the university in Glasgow, studying engineering.
